Bray Wanderers 2 Galway United's hopes of U-21 glory ended in Bray on Saturday when they were defeated in the semi-finals of the Enda McGuill League Cup. United squandered a glorious with a missed penalty in the opening half but Cathal Fahy equalised after Bray hit the front. However, Billy Clery's men were unable to get on top and Bray sealed a place in the final against Derry City with a second goal. Galway United: John Egan, Darwin Dowling, Paul Sinnott, Tommy Walsh (c), Willie McDonagh, Ronan O'Boyle (Stephen Cunningham, 80), Jonathan Keane, Eoin McCormack, Keith Ward (Alfredo Neto, 76), Cathal Fahy, Jason Molloy. |
